B-Dudley Port-Sedgley Road East Junction


Problems

The Dudley Port Junction is an area that suffers heavy congestion in the morning and evening peak hours. Pedestrian crossing facilities are inadequate and cars park along both arms of the Sedgley Road East contributing to delay along this section for both buses and general traffic.



Proposals

  • The introduction of dedicated parking lay-bys on Sedgley Road East on both sides of the junction.
  • Formalise an area of parking to the west of the junction to provide formal offstreet parking.
  • A parking lay-by to be provided to the least of the junction, partly in the footway, to provide further parking.
  • Red route controls through the junction to control parking on-street.
  • Bus stop upgrades to Bus Showcase standard to improve access to buses.
  • Improved cycle facilities through the provision of advanced cycle stop lines.
  • High friction surfacing on approaches to the junction.
  • Provide controlled crossing facilities for pedestrians.


Possible benefits

  • Improved pedestrian facilities to provide safer crossing points.
  • Improved traffic flow.
  • Improved parking management and formalised parking facilities off-street.
  • Improved safety for cyclists.


Design Changes Since Consultation


Since the Consultation in 2008 a number of revisions have been made to the proposals for the corridor. The following design changes have been made to this junction:
  1. Design Change 006 - At the junction of Sedgley Road East and Dudley Port the Pedestrian Refuge Layouts are to be revised to provide a Reverse stagger. A bus lane has also been shown on the northbound exit from the junction.
